(Alliance News) - EDX Medical Group PLC on Monday said it has raised GBP2.7 million through a share subscription at 14 pence per share.
The Cambridge, England-based developer of digital diagnostic products and services said the funding will be used to support the expansion of its new employee health screening service.
Shares in EDX Medical rose 23% to 12.00 pence on Monday in London.
The company said discussions on definitive contracts are progressing well for the provision of the health screening service to three significant UK employers. Testing is expected to begin in the fourth quarter of 2026. Two further large companies have approached EDX Medical to explore the provision of the service, with discussions ongoing.
EDX Medical said it had deferred recognition of GBP860,000 in revenue into the current financial year, after previously expecting to record revenue of GBP1.2 million for the year ended March 31, 2026. The company said this was because processing of the orders extended beyond the end of the financial year.
Founder Chris Evans said: "Investors in the company have again demonstrated their confidence in the company's strategy to provide class-leading diagnostic tests and fully support the expansion of our employee health screening programme where employers and employees can both reap the benefits of highly accurate tests which assess risks across a very wide range of health conditions and illnesses."
